Output ec59c9372c5ccd6894de7cc9e359e6d18e2be35489a9afe4b3f86898b6d8cf96:0

value
58158000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c4b12af642e2212a7ddbb088fc1dc65353058dc OP_EQUAL
address
3A722MXzVdTzYf7PtcDPz9ZHS4j2QVFzqf
transaction
ec59c9372c5ccd6894de7cc9e359e6d18e2be35489a9afe4b3f86898b6d8cf96
confirmations
363654
spent
true